It uses a digital bicycle speedometer to count pulses from a magnet and reed switch on the anemometer cup assembly, and the speedometer translates this automatically to mph or kph. It also keeps track of your maximum gust, average windspeed, and total wind miles -- so it works as a wind odometer too! Very useful for doing wind power site evaluations. Parts List • Digital Bicycle Speedometer -- We used a Sigma Sport Targa because of the peak speed, average, and odometer features. It's available at almost any bicycle shop for about US$25. • Anemometer Cup and Hub Assembly -- You could use any commercial or homebuilt cup assembly for this. Check out our page for details on how to build your own. • NdFeB Magnet -- The magnet that comes with the speedometer is a rod shape, and we found it easier to fit a 3/8 inch diameter by 1/16 inch thick disc magnet to the cup assembly rather than the rod. It's Item #75 on our Shopping Cart, and costs only US$0.20. • Bearing Assembly -- Many different designs of bearing assembly will work. You want it to spin as freely as possible, so you can get better response and also measure very low wind speeds. For this project, we used the same ball bearing DC brushless PM motor as in our, and we removed the coils to make it spin more freely.we just need the bearing for this project. The motor costs only US$2.50. It's Item#2105 on our shopping cart. You could use any sort of bearing assembly you can devise from scratch, just make sure it spins VERY freely. • PVC reducer fitting -- 2 inch to 1.5 inch white PVC reducer coupling. • 3 Machine screws -- #4-40, 1/4 inch long. • Glue -- epoxy, PVC cement, and thread lock compound are needed. • Tap -- a #4-40 tap, available at hardware stores. ![]() • Mounting supplies -- 1.5 inch diameter PVC pipe for mast; telephone or other thin wire to extend sensor wire. Assembly Cut the PVC pipe reducer off with a hacksaw right at the flange, on the big 2 inch side. This gives a wide, tapered rim surface to mount the bearing assembly to.
